Essential Power Needs for Off-Grid RV Living
When you transition to off-grid living, your power needs shift from simple convenience to essential infrastructure. You aren’t just charging phones anymore; you are managing the energy required for LED lighting, water pumps, refrigeration, and critical communication devices. Understanding your baseline load is the foundation of a successful trip.
The reality of RV life is that your power needs will fluctuate based on the season and your location. A sunny week in the desert allows for heavy solar reliance, while a rainy week in the Pacific Northwest forces you to rely entirely on your stored capacity. Always aim for a setup that provides at least 20% more power than your calculated daily usage to account for unexpected weather or device charging.

Factors to Consider When Choosing RV Power
When shopping for a power bank, don’t just look at the total capacity; look at the inverter size. The inverter determines the maximum wattage you can pull at one time, which is critical if you want to run high-draw items like a toaster or a hair dryer. Always check the "continuous" wattage rating rather than the "surge" rating to avoid overloading your unit.
Portability and weight are equally important, especially if you have a smaller rig with limited payload capacity. Consider where you will store the unit; it needs to be somewhere with adequate ventilation to prevent overheating during use. Finally, look at the port selection—ensure it has the specific USB-C, AC, and DC outputs required for your current fleet of devices.
Calculating Your Daily Watt-Hour Consumption
To calculate your needs, list every device you plan to power and find its wattage on the label or manual. Multiply the wattage by the number of hours you intend to use it each day to get your daily watt-hour (Wh) consumption. For example, a 50-watt laptop used for 4 hours equals 200 watt-hours of daily usage.
- Small electronics (phones, tablets): 5–15 Wh per charge
- Laptops: 50–100 Wh per charge
- LED Lights: 5–10 Wh per hour
- Small 12V Fridge: 300–600 Wh per day
Always add a 20% buffer to your final total to account for inverter inefficiency and power loss during transmission. This simple math prevents the dreaded "dead battery" scenario in the middle of a trip.
Managing Battery Health for Long-Term Use
Modern lithium power stations are robust, but they aren’t invincible. Avoid leaving your unit in a hot vehicle or direct sunlight for extended periods, as extreme heat is the fastest way to degrade battery chemistry. If you aren’t using your power station for a month or more, try to store it at roughly 50% to 80% charge rather than leaving it completely empty or at 100%.
Most importantly, respect the charging cycles. While modern batteries don’t suffer from the "memory effect" of old tech, they do have a finite lifespan. By keeping your unit clean, dry, and away from extreme temperatures, you can ensure it remains a reliable part of your kit for years of adventure.
